Who We’re Looking For A focused, competitive, and hardworking individual who excels in creating opportunities and building relationships. As a Technical Recruiter, you will play a pivotal role in sourcing senior consultants and contractors to meet client needs across diverse industries.

What You’ll Do

Creatively source and recruit senior consultants/contractors through referrals, prospecting, and cold calling

Build a robust pipeline of highly qualified candidates to meet client demands

Cultivate and maintain long‑term relationships with consultants, ensuring satisfaction and repeat business

Utilize CRM tools, LinkedIn, and other platforms to track and gather market intelligence

Negotiate competitive pay rates to attract top talent

Collaborate closely with account executives to fulfill client staffing requirements efficiently

Strive to meet and exceed daily and weekly performance targets
